India, Sept. 15 -- PM Modi today on Sunday inaugurated the bioethanol plant and laid the foundation stone of the polypropylene unit at Numaligarh Refinery Limited (NRL) in Golaghat district of Assam. On this occasion, he said that India is moving strongly towards becoming self-reliant in its energy needs.
The Prime Minister greeted the people present at the event on Shardiya Durga Puja and paid tribute to saint Srimanta Sankardev on his birth anniversary. He informed that projects worth about Rs 18,000 crore have been allocated to Assam, which will accelerate the pace of development of the state and create new opportunities for farmers and youth.
